Retail is about people — how they shop, how they move, how they experience everyday life. For over five decades, we’ve worked alongside ASDA as those habits and expectations have evolved.

Our relationship began in the early 1970s, supporting the delivery of some of the UK’s first purpose-built supermarkets. ASDA had a bold ambition: to make grocery shopping more accessible, efficient and customer-focused. We helped translate that ambition into spaces that felt clear, welcoming and easy to use.

As the retail landscape has changed, so too has the estate — but the shared goal has remained the same: create stores that work better for people and perform strongly for the business.
